As an authoritative film critic, I consider director Chris Appelhans’ 'Wish Dragon' a significant animated feature. The film captivates with its vibrant 3D animation, seamlessly blending contemporary visual aesthetics with traditional Chinese artistic elements, notably in the majestic yet charming portrayal of Long Shen. The astute contrast between bustling, modernized Shanghai and its humble neighborhoods is subtly conveyed through color and composition, establishing a vivid backdrop for the narrative.
The voice acting is a profound strength. John Cho masterfully imbues Long Shen with a compelling mix of humor, profound philosophy, and a world-weary tone that ultimately finds joy. Jimmy Wong brilliantly captures Din's earnest innocence and youthful exuberance, forging a central duo with undeniable chemistry. The film’s core message—that true wealth lies in friendship, family, and self-worth—is exceptionally potent and timely. It deftly communicates a lesson on gratitude and connection transcending materialism.
Within the cinematic landscape, despite its familiar "genie in a bottle" trope, 'Wish Dragon' establishes its unique identity through its distinctive Chinese cultural essence. It’s a pivotal work, contributing to the global ascent of Asian animation, offering a fresh, heartwarming perspective on dreams, aspirations, and the meaning of genuine happiness. A highly recommended family film that resonates deeply with audiences of all ages.
